On some of our arm targets, we get various -mfpu flags implicitly or explicitly passed to the compiler during test runs. The target options pushed in arm_neon.h that affect vmmlaq_s32 set isa_bit_neon, but the caller doesn't have that bit set, so arm_can_inline_p rejects the attempt to inline it, and the test fails.
An explicit -mfpu=neon would address the compile problem, but cause the assembler to reject the generated code. So this patch adds -mfpu=auto to the test, overriding any implicit flags with the fpu implied by the arch. Regstrapped on x86_64-linux-gnu, also tested on x-arm-wrs-vxworks7r2.
